Yes. Regarding economic crimes, as I said, we have several reports and we have also obtained from the Banque de la République d'Haïti copies of cheques signed by Jean-Claude Duvalier himself and by his ministers or director generals. So, we have all that evidence.
Regarding crimes against humanity, there are witnesses and plaintiffs that have already pressed charges. In addition, the investigating judge's office has already heard from some witnesses. Here, in Canada, I met on Friday evening with several Canadians of Haitian descent who want to press charges against Mr. Duvalier. We will do what is necessary to make sure those charges do make their way to the prosecutor in Port-au-Prince or to the office of the investigating judge who will hear the case.
